找到 2636 篇文章 關於 Java

Java 中 int 可以為 null 嗎?

kavan singh
更新於 2024-09-19 23:01:21

73 次檢視

不,在 Java 中,int 不能為 null。有一些原始資料型別,int 是 Java 程式語言中的其中一種原始資料型別。int 資料型別的預設值為 0,它不能為 null。不同的原始資料型別有不同的預設值,但 Java 中的物件可以為 null。原始資料型別(例如 int、float 等)沒有 null 引用概念。示例例如,如果您嘗試將 null 分配給 int 變數,則會生成錯誤。int myInt = null; 如何… 閱讀更多

Java 程式查詢給定棧的頂部和底部元素

Shubham B Vora
更新於 2024-09-23 19:34:09

2K+ 次檢視

在本教程中,我們將瞭解如何使用 Java 查詢給定棧的頂部和底部元素。當我們檢視棧時,它表示一個線性資料集,遵循後進先出 (LIFO) 原則,因此元素在同一位置新增和刪除。我們將進一步探討兩種查詢給定棧的頂部和底部元素的方法,即透過迭代和遞迴。問題陳述我們將得到一個包含 n 個元素的棧陣列,任務是找到棧的第 1 個和第 n 個元素,而無需… 閱讀更多

Java:從日期獲取月份整數

Nickey Bricks
更新於 2024-09-10 11:56:12

86 次檢視

問題陳述從日期物件中提取月份作為整數對於開發人員來說是一項基本技能。這是因為您可能會遇到需要生成月度報告、按月份過濾日期以及安排事件等類似任務。在本文中,我們將嘗試熟悉 Java 強大的日期和時間 API。先決條件讓我們深入探討手頭的 Java 任務,確保您考慮以下幾點。確保您熟悉基本的 Java 語法,尤其是日期和時間 API。您將使用類似於… 閱讀更多

Java 中的最大子陣列和:Kadane 演算法

Mohammed Shahnawaz Alam
更新於 2024-09-09 01:16:26

108 次檢視

在這裡,我們將學習如何使用 Java 中的 Kadane 演算法查詢最大子陣列和?問題陳述給定一個大小為 N 的陣列,編寫一個 Java 程式以使用 Kadane 演算法查詢最大子陣列和。示例輸入:n = 5 arr[] = 1, 2, 3, -2, 5 輸出:最大子陣列和為:9 什麼是 Kadane 演算法 Kadane 演算法幫助我們以 O(n) 的時間複雜度找到最大子陣列和。使用 Kadane 演算法查詢最大子陣列和的步驟初始化 2 個名為 currentSum=Integer.MIN_VALUE 和 maxSum=… 閱讀更多

Java 程式計算所有棧元素

Shubham B Vora
更新於 2024-09-10 09:50:50

2K+ 次檢視

在本教程中,我們將學習如何使用各種方法計算棧中的元素數量。在 Java 中,棧是一種基本的資料結構,遵循後進先出 (LIFO) 原則,這意味著最近新增到棧的任何元素都將首先被訪問。棧的即時應用包括函式呼叫管理、表示式求值等。在這些場景中,我們可能需要計算棧元素的數量。例如,在使用棧進行函式呼叫管理時計算函式呼叫的總數,以及在評估時要執行的操作總數… 閱讀更多

檢查棧元素在 Java 中是否成對連續

Prasanna D
更新於 2024-09-19 22:00:31

21 次檢視

棧是計算機科學中一種基本的資料結構,通常因其後進先出 (LIFO) 屬性而被使用。在使用棧時可能會遇到一個有趣的問題,即檢查棧的元素是否成對連續。在本文中,我們將學習使用 Java 解決此問題,確保解決方案高效且清晰。問題陳述給定一個整數棧,任務是確定棧的元素是否成對連續。如果兩個元素之間的差值正好為 1,則認為它們是連續的。輸入 4, 5, 2, 3, 10, 11 輸出元素是否成對連續?true… 閱讀更多

Java 程式從單鏈表中刪除所有偶數節點

John Wick
更新於 2024-09-18 21:54:29

113 次檢視

在本文中,我們將學習如何在 Java 中從單鏈表中刪除所有偶數節點。此 Java 程式演示瞭如何建立和管理單鏈表,包括新增節點、刪除偶數值節點以及列印列表。您將瞭解如何插入節點、刪除偶數值節點以及顯示剩餘節點。單鏈表由節點組成,每個節點有兩個部分:一部分儲存資料,另一部分儲存下一個節點的地址。此設定僅允許單向遍歷,因為每個節點… 閱讀更多

Java 程式從給定棧中刪除重複元素

Anh Tran Tuan
更新於 2024-08-14 18:45:36

208 次檢視

在本文中,我們將探討兩種在 Java 中從棧中刪除重複元素的方法。我們將比較使用巢狀迴圈的簡單方法和使用 HashSet 的更有效的方法。目標是演示如何最佳化重複刪除以及評估每種方法的效能。問題陳述編寫一個 Java 程式以從棧中刪除重複元素。輸入 Stack data = initData(10L); 輸出使用樸素方法的唯一元素:[1, 4, 3, 2, 8, 7, 5] 使用樸素方法花費的時間:18200 納秒使用最佳化方法的唯一元素:[1, 4, 3, 2,… 閱讀更多

Java 中具有不同方法的給定和的子陣列

Areeba Rashid
更新於 2024-08-14 22:07:51

86 次檢視

查詢具有給定和的子陣列是一個常見問題,通常出現在編碼面試和競賽程式設計中。可以使用多種技術來解決此問題,每種技術在時間複雜度和空間複雜度方面都有其自身的權衡。在本文中,我們將探討在 Java 中解決查詢具有給定和的子陣列問題的多種方法。問題陳述給定一個整數陣列和一個目標和,在陣列中找到一個連續的子陣列,該子陣列加起來等於給定的和。問題可以分為兩個主要變體:子陣列… 閱讀更多

在 Java 中向儲存的聯絡人傳送簡訊提醒

Harsh Laghave
更新於 2024-08-17 21:29:32

100 次檢視

使用 Java 傳送簡訊提醒的步驟在本文中,我們將探討如何使用 Java 向儲存的聯絡人傳送簡訊提醒。我們將指導您如何使用 Java 向儲存或未儲存的聯絡人傳送簡訊提醒。以下是執行此操作的步驟:設定簡訊提供商的帳戶。將提供商的 Java 庫新增到您的專案中。編寫 Java 程式碼以傳送簡訊。讓我們詳細說明以上步驟。設定帳戶首先,我們需要設定… 閱讀更多

廣告